Landscaping Amarillo

Tree Care of Amarillo

Address
3511 Se 15th Ave
Place
Amarillo , TX 79105-1943
Landline
(806) 379-6060

Description

Tree Care of Amarillo can be found at 3511 Se 15th Ave . The following is offered: Landscaping - In Amarillo there are 3 other Landscaping.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Landscaping
(806)379-6060 (806)-379-6060 +18063796060

Map 3511 Se 15th Ave